Description:
Funding will support research and development to identify solutions to National Defence’s Moral Trauma on the Frontline – See, Prevent and Treat Challenge. Defence Research and Development Canada (DRDC) in collaboration with Canada’s defence, security and public safety communities are looking for state-of-the-art research on “moral injury” and cutting edge prevention models and treatment strategies, in support of DND/CAF personnel, healthcare workers and First Responders at the front lines of the current pandemic, in order to provide for the long-term mental health of these populations.

Expected Results:

The Department of National Defence solicited proposals to address challenges that arose as a result of a pandemic. The expected results are aimed to strengthen Canada’s response to pandemics, through the development of strategies to care for front line workers.
